2.0 out of 5 stars Get a proper compilation and avoid this ugly retread --, January 13, 2001
By 
This review is from: Bugs Bunny Easter Funnies [VHS] (VHS Tape)
In this 1979 video, Granny looks for a toon to play the bunny in her easter production. Bugs and his pals audition for Granny with clips of their classic shows; the easter plot is just an excuse to revisit the same old cartoons. And as in most retrospectives, the older material is much better than the filler: in this case it's funnier, more vibrant, and has vastly superior voice acting and animation. Shamefully, the glorious classics are cut into the newer junk with such butchery their genius is nearly ruined, and my friend and I decided we'd prefer them in their original state.

5.0 out of 5 stars Bugs, Where Are You When We Need You?, June 28, 2000
By 
W. Langan "take403" (the end of the world to your town!) - See all my reviews
(REAL NAME)   
This review is from: Bugs Bunny Easter Funnies [VHS] (VHS Tape)
Bugs Bunny is not able to play the Easter Rabbit, so other Looney Tunes alumni are asked- like Foghorn, I say, Foghorn Leghorn, Porky Pig, and Pepe LePew (who has one of the best lines: "Moi playing le Easter Bunny would be like Robert Redford playing le Fonz!"). And so Daffy Duck enthusiastically volunteers his services but doesn't get the job!
